    VINAVIL 4555
    VINAVIL 4555 is an anionic/non-ionic water dispersion of vinyl-acetate/vinyl-versatate
    copolymer with 55% solid content, free from solvents (plasticizer and coalescing agents)
    and from alkylphenol-ethoxylates (APEO-free).
PACKAGING
STORAGE
    APPLICATIONS
    VINAVIL 4555 is suitable for formulating interior/exterior   at high PVC, formulated with VINAVIL 4555, are cha-
    paints and textured coatings, satin and gloss paints with    racterised by high wet scrub resistance. When used
    good adhesion and sheen.                                     in water paints, the binding power of VINAVIL 4555
    Thanks to its special characteristics, formulates con-       is best expressed when coalescing agents are added
    taining VINAVIL 4555 have good rheological properties        to lower the filming temperature. The amount used de-
    and excellent dirt pick-up resistance.                       pends on the effectiveness of the coalescing agent. For
    Thanks to its high resistance to alkalinity and good         diethylenglycol monobutyl ether acetate, for example,
    weather resistance, it may also be used in the prepa-        the amount required is 2-3% on the VINAVIL 4555 in
    ration of exterior paints and textured coatings. Paints      the formulation.

     RAVEMUL T37
     RAVEMUL T37 is a water dispersion of vinyl-acetate terpolymer with versatic acid
     esthers. Ravemul T37 is free from alkylphenol-ethoxylates (APEO-free).
PACKAGING
STORAGE
     APPLICATIONS
     RAVEMUL T37 is particularly suitable for use in lime-ba-           ter resistant. Moreover, thanks to the high alkali resistance
     sed paints and coatings for intumescent and fire-retardant         and excellent compatibility with cement, it is recommended
     paints. Thanks to its high alkali resistance, it is also used as   for applications where the following performance characte-
     an additive for cement-based systems such as repair mor-           ristics need to be improved: adhesion to the substrate, fle-
     tars, construction joints, grout protection and thermal insu-      xibility, dimensional stability during the drying phase, resi-
     lation finishing systems (EIFS).                                   stance to wear and reduction of water permeability.
     RAVEMUL T37 is particularly recommended where good                 RAVEMUL T37 is highly compatible and stable in lime-ba-
     hydrophobicity is required, being the polymer film highly wa-      sed paints.

     VINAVIL EVA 4612
     VINAVIL EVA 4612 is a water dispersion of vinyl-acetate/ethylene copolymer, free from
     solvents (plasticizer and coalescing agents), alkylphenol-ethoxylates (APEO-free) and is
     characterised by very low free monomer content.
PACKAGING
STORAGE
     APPLICATIONS
     VINAVIL EVA 4612 is odourless and suitable for the pre-         pes very good rheology to make application easier, high
     paration of interior/exterior paints, including those at high   binding, hiding properties and excellent compatibility with
     PVC, satin paints and wall textured coatings where a low        pigment pastes. Thanks to the presence of ethylene in the
     content of volatile organic compounds (VOC) is required.        monomer composition, VINAVIL EVA 4612 has a mini-
     VINAVIL EVA 4612 allows the formulation of paints in            mum film-forming temperature (MFFT) of 0°C. This pro-
     accordance to Ecolabel norms, which are identified by a         perty allows painting products to be formulated without
     specific labelling.                                             the use of coalescing agents and plasticizer, which redu-
     The VINAVIL EVA 4612 contained in formulates develo-            ces VOC content to levels well below 1 g/l.
